7. Add MS 47864
- Reference (shelfmark):
- Add MS 47864
- Title:
- MEYERSTEIN BEQUEST. Vol. XXV (ff. iii+ 117). William Wordsworth''s Poems, in Two Volumes, 1807: the printer''s manuscript, conveyed in packets from Coleorton to the publishers Longman, Hurst, Rees and Orme between 14 Nov. 1806 (postmark on f. 2b) and circ. early Apr. 1807. Partly autograph, with revisions and annotations throughout by the poet.
- Scope & Content:
- © Dove Cottage - Wordsworth Trust. Most of the texts are revised from an earlier collection of shorter poems transcribed circ. Jan.- Mar. 1806 by Dorothy Wordsworth and Sara Hutchinson, of which sixtyeight octavo leaves or fragments of leaves survive here. Poems from the same and other sources w...

9. Add MS 47865-47866
- Reference (shelfmark):
- Add MS 47865-47866
- Title:
- Vols. XXVI, XXVII (ff. ii+212, ii+259). Letter-books of George Symes Catcott relating to the Chatterton-Rowley controversy; 1764-1799. Transcribed from the original letter-book in Bristol Central Library (MS. 5342) by Maria George, 1883 (see 47865, f. 1), and others. Belonged to William George of Bristol.
